Scottish Development International (SDI) is the economic development agency of the Scottish Government. We encourage investment in Scotland and support Scottish companies to trade internationally. SDI is looking to recruit an Inward Investment Manager (Lead Generation) based in Beijing to support SDI operations in mainland China.

Working as part of the SDI Global Lead Generation team, the Inward Investment Manager (Lead Generation) will stimulate company leads for new investment projects and customer engagement activities to secure qualified inward investment project opportunites.

The job holder will manage their own dedicated exisiting-Investor portfolio and a target list of companies to engage with. The job holder will exercise discretion take decisions, manage and improve processes and represent the organisation where necessary in their area of responsibility. Working as part of the wider global Business Development team, the job holder will contribute directly to the generation of a pipeline of new inward investment opportunities for Scotland. Through the performance of their role they will be required to provide information and make recommendations to more senior Grades.
